    ARP 2600 V is a faithful recreation of one of the most versatile and iconic synthesizers of all time. Learn this semi-modular synth inside and out, with this in-depth course by trainer and producer Rishabh Rajan! Created in the early ’70s by Alan R. Pearlman (his initials is where the name ARP comes from) with David Friend and Lewis G. Pollock, the ARP 2600 is considered by many to be the holy grail of analog synthesizers. Heard on countless records (Stevie Wonder, Genesis, The Who, Jean Michel Jarre, Depeche Mode to name a few), this semi-modular analog monster was even used to create the voice of R2-D2 in Star Wars.
